The 12 Best Beaches in the Izmir Region

The coastline around Izmir is one of the most beautiful in the Aegean Sea. With turquoise water, soft sandy beaches, hidden coves, and stylish beach clubs, the Izmir region offers something for every traveler—from quiet nature escapes to lively resort beaches.

Here are 12 of the best beaches in the Izmir region.

  1. Ilıca Beach – The Most Famous Beach
    Ilıca Beach

Located near Çeşme, Ilıca Beach is one of the most popular beaches in the Aegean.

Highlights:

long stretch of white sand

shallow warm water

natural thermal springs mixing with the sea.

It is perfect for families and swimming.

  1. Altınkum Beach – Crystal Clear Waters
    Altınkum Beach

Altınkum (meaning “Golden Sand”) is famous for:

incredibly clear water

golden sand

calm atmosphere.

The water here is usually cooler and refreshing during summer.

  1. Alaçatı Beach – Windsurfing Paradise
    Alaçatı Beach

Near Alaçatı, this beach is one of the world’s top windsurfing destinations.

Why visitors love it:

steady winds

shallow lagoon waters

stylish beach clubs.

  1. Pırlanta Beach – Wide Sandy Coast
    Pırlanta Beach

This large beach is known for:

wide sandy shoreline

strong winds ideal for kitesurfing

beautiful sunset views.

  1. Delikli Koy – Hidden Natural Cove
    Delikli Koy

Delikli Koy is one of the most photogenic beaches near Izmir.

Unique features:

rock formations with natural holes

crystal-clear turquoise water

peaceful natural environment.

  1. Boyalık Beach – Calm and Relaxing
    Boyalık Beach

Located close to the center of Çeşme, Boyalık Beach offers:

soft sand

calm sea

beautiful coastal scenery.

It’s ideal for relaxing beach days.

  1. Akkum Beach – Seferihisar’s Best Beach
    Akkum Beach

Near Seferihisar, this beach is known for:

clean water

windsurfing spots

peaceful coastal views.

  1. Sazlıca Beach – Quiet Hidden Bay
    Sazlıca Beach

Located near Foça, Sazlıca Beach offers:

beautiful rocky coves

deep blue sea

quieter atmosphere than the Çeşme beaches.

  1. Mersinaki Beach – Foça’s Secret Spot
    Mersinaki Beach

This small hidden beach is perfect for:

snorkeling

peaceful swimming

nature lovers.

  1. Pamucak Beach – Near Ephesus
    Pamucak Beach

Located close to the ancient city of Ephesus, Pamucak Beach offers:

a long natural sandy coast

fewer crowds than resort beaches

beautiful views of the Aegean.

  1. Çark Beach – Windsurfing Hub
    Çark Beach

A favorite among windsurfing enthusiasts thanks to:

strong winds

professional surf schools

lively beach clubs.

  1. Demircili Beach – Natural Beauty
    Demircili Beach

Near Urla, this beach is surrounded by hills and nature.

Features:

crystal-clear water

quiet environment

scenic landscapes.

Best Time to Visit Izmir Beaches

Ideal months:

May – June

September – October

Summer (July–August) is great for beach clubs but can be very busy.
